Minutes — Management Meeting, Supplier Contract Renewal

Attendees discussed the renewal of the Velmora Components agreement ahead of its expiry. Procurement presented benchmarking showing a possible eight percent saving if volumes consolidate at the Dunbarrow facility. Legal flagged the termination-notice clause as needing revision. Action: draft revised terms for review within two weeks. For the incoming director, the wider context shaping our negotiating position is recorded in the confidential note below.

internal memo for kawip-hadug: Headcount on the Wenwyn team goes from 7 to 140 by the end of January. Gross margin on Wenwyn came in at 20 percent against a plan of 15 percent.

To the dispatch desk — re: prototype shipment. We need the two Veldt-9 prototype units sent to the Carrowby test lab on Thursday. Both units are packed in the foam-lined cases in the secure cupboard; please do not repack or open them, as the tamper seals must remain intact for the lab's intake process. Book a single dedicated run, no shared loads. The hand-over instruction for the courier is set out below.

dispatch memo: the lamwyn fenwyn courier leaves the wenir ledger at gate 7175 under passcode 822969

Audit item 7: Leaked-file-descriptor hunt, Ironvale gateway fleet. Confirm descriptor counts were sampled across all nodes over a 72-hour window. Verify the Fdsweep report flags zero growth trends post-patch. Check that the faulty socket-pool change was reverted and the regression test added. Confirm lsof snapshots were retained for the audit record. Reviewer must record the remediation owner below.

named custodian: Oliath Ralax

### WebSocket compression on Larkwire

Per-message deflate saves bandwidth on chatty Larkwire streams, but it chews CPU and adds latency spikes on small frames. Tell customers to enable it only for payloads over a few KB. To reproduce their setup against our staging gateway, authenticate with the internal key below.

API key for tagug-tajef: vxb4-R1fo